How good were these things?
They raced against other FWD cars and had an evo engine with a sequential FWD 6 speed gearbox.
What were it's competitors?
Posted: Tue Feb 01, 2005 4:46 am
by salacious
The Taeivon FTO was in the GT300 class which also included MR2, RX7, 911 GT2, Silva, BMW, Celica, Skyline and Imprezza

How come they chose an FTO to race against those other, seemingly more fierce competitors?
It did good though for what it is (FWD)
Seeing as it's racing Mugen NSX, calsonic GT-R's, Porsche's and so on
Posted: Tue Feb 01, 2005 10:59 am
by FTO338
The NSX, GTR, & Porsches are at the GT500 Glass. As salacious said, the FTO was in the GT300 Class, which should be against cars like MR2, Silvia.......
